Marius1 Posted March 27 Share Posted March 27 Een vraag van een beginner: Ik heb een record op het scherm. Hoe kan ik het RecordID ervan in het clipboard van Windows krijgen? Ik moet daarvoor een Button programmeren, maar ik weet niet hoe. Quote Link to comment
0 bigbadwolf Posted March 28 Share Posted March 28 Het kan op een aantal manieren, maar in basis zul je een veld moeten maken waar je het in zet om het daarne te kopiƫren. Set Field [ GLOBAL::RecordID_g ; Get ( RecordID ) ] Copy [ Select ; GLOBAL::RecordID_g ] Let op dat het veld met het record ID op de lay-out staat (mag naast het zichtbare deel, maar het moet er zijn). Anders kun je de inhoud niet overnemen op het klembord. In plaats van een globaal veld kun je ook een calculatieveld maken. Wat je zelf prettiger vindt. Quote Link to comment
0 peerke Posted March 28 Share Posted March 28 Als het record al voor staat, heb je de global niet nodig. Copy [ Select; Tabel::RecordID] is dan voldoende. Mits RecordID op de layout staat. Als je de inhoud van het klembord extern nodig hebt, zal het zo moeten. Als je de inhoud van het klembord binnen je fm oplossing nodig hebt, is het geen fraaie oplossing elders met een 'plak' te werken. Beter met een variabele. P. Quote Link to comment
Question
Marius1
Een vraag van een beginner:
Ik heb een record op het scherm. Hoe kan ik het RecordID ervan in het clipboard van Windows krijgen?
Ik moet daarvoor een Button programmeren, maar ik weet niet hoe.
Link to comment
2 answers to this question
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.